《玩转未来视界:Unity AR/VR开发深度揭秘》
随着增强现实(AR)和虚拟现实(VR)技术的迅猛发展,Unity作为领先的游戏和实时3D开发平台,成为了AR/VR开发者的首选工具。本文将深度揭秘如何利用Unity进行AR/VR开发,帮助你掌握核心技术,实现未来视界的精彩创作。
## 一、Unity与AR/VR概述
– **Unity简介**:Unity提供强大的跨平台支持和丰富的开发生态,适合构建沉浸式体验。
– **AR/VR区别**:AR是在现实环境上叠加数字信息,VR则是完全虚拟的沉浸式环境。
– **应用场景**:游戏娱乐、教育培训、工业设计、医疗康复等。
## 二、Unity AR开发核心技术
1. **AR Foundation框架**
– 支持跨平台AR开发(iOS的ARKit,Android的ARCore)。
– 提供平面检测、环境理解、光照估计等功能。
2. **环境理解与平面检测**
– 利用摄像头和传感器数据实现地面、墙壁等平面识别。
3. **物体追踪和交互**
– 结合图像识别和三维物体跟踪实现精准定位与交互。
4. **光照与阴影**
– 实现虚拟物体与现实环境光照的一致性,提升真实感。
5. **性能优化**
– 移动设备性能有限,通过简化模型、减少DrawCall等手段提升流畅度。
## 三、Unity VR开发关键点
1. **VR硬件支持**
– Oculus Quest、HTC Vive、Valve Index等主流设备。
– 利用Unity XR Plugin管理多种设备接口。
2. **空间定位与环境构建**
– 构建虚拟空间,设计交互场景与路径。
3. **交互设计**
– 手势识别、控制器输入、多点触控,实现自然交互。
4. **沉浸感提升**
– 高帧率渲染、低延迟响应、环境音效添加。
5. **用户舒适度**
– 避免眩晕设计,合理控制移动速度与视角转换。
## 四、开发流程与实用工具
1. **开发流程**
– 需求分析 → 原型设计 → 场景构建 → 交互实现 → 测试调优 → 发布部署。
2. **实用插件与工具**
– Vuforia、ARKit XR Plugin、Google ARCore SDK。
– SteamVR Plugin、Oculus Integration。
– Shader Forge、Amplify Shader Editor(视觉效果制作)。
3. **调试与测试**
– 使用Unity的Play Mode模拟。
– 真机测试及性能监测工具(Profiler)。
## 五、未来趋势与挑战
– **技术融合**:AI与AR/VR结合,实现智能交互。
– **硬件进化**:轻量化设备和高性能芯片推动体验升级。
– **内容生态**:丰富内容与社交元素驱动用户增长。
– **挑战**:隐私安全、标准统一、用户适应性。
## 结语
用Unity玩转未来视界,不仅是一场技术的冒险,更是创意的释放。掌握Unity AR/VR开发的核心秘诀,你将站在技术与创意的最前沿,开启无限可能的未来视界。
如果你有具体的项目需求或开发问题,也欢迎随时提问!
资源下载版权声明
- 本网站名称:阿铭资源讯息网
- 本站永久网址:https://www.cqxlsm.org/
- 用户均应仔细阅读以下声明。使用本站资源的行为将视为对本声明全部内容的认可。
- 下载本站资源请在法律允许范围内使用,请勿用于非法用途,否则产生的一切后果自负。
- 文章相关资源,不保证100%完整安全可用、不提供任何技术支持。资源仅供大家学习与参考。
- 注册本站以及在本站充值羊毛、开通会员等消费行为仅作为用户本人对本站的友情赞助,均为用户本人自愿行为。相当于您是自愿赞助本站的服务器以及运营维护费用,而不是购买本站的任何服务与资源,请知悉!
- 本站资源大多存储在云盘,若链接失效,请联系我们第一时间更新。如有侵权,请联系[email protected]处理。
- 原文链接:https://www.cqxlsm.org/2733.htm转载请注明出处。


评论0